One-time Formula One world champion Jenson Button has admitted that he's got no regrets about the time in which he finished in F1. The 39-year-old called it a day in the sport in 2017 after a 17-year career which included 15 race wins and 50 podiums.

The Brit featured for several different teams across his career, including Renault and McLaren, entering 309 Grand Prixs in total.

" A lot has changed in my life since I left Formula 1 and for the better, " Button told Sky Sports.

" It was the right time to leave, even though I see the cars on track and love seeing them and hearing them I do miss it.

" A lot has happened since I left F1."

Button accumulated 1235 points across his career with his first race win coming in Hungary in 2006.
